Denver Broncos quarterback Trevor Siemian started Wednesday’s practice with a few throws during the team’s warm up, according to reporters present at the Broncos’ facilities. Denver’s second-year quarterback did not throw at the team’s practice on Tuesday because of shoulder soreness.

If he wants to remain in the running for the Broncos’ starting quarterback job, he will have to avoid missing too many more reps during practice. Siemian will need as many opportunities as he can get to open the regular season as the starter if the battle between the Denver quarterbacks is truly as close as their coaching staff has made it seem.
He is scheduled to start on Saturday for the Broncos when they play the Los Angeles Rams in Denver.
Fantasy impact: For 2016, Siemian has little to no fantasy value. He could possibly become an option for fantasy owners after a few games if he continues to start for the Broncos, but it is incredibly hard to gauge how a player who only has one pass attempt in his NFL career will perform.
